Subject: DR drill results — webhook retry semantics (for weekly sync)

Team,

Thursday's disaster-recovery drill on the Quillbrook delivery service went well. We confirmed webhook retries back off exponentially with a six-attempt cap, and that replays after regional failover deduplicate correctly. One gap: the standby region's signing keystore had to be restored manually, which added eleven minutes. Restoring it requires the recovery passphrase, recorded below.

unlock words, yawig-kagef: gordor-holvan-ulaael-pramir-ulaiel-tamdor

## Authentication

The Lantermill export client authenticates against the internal Chronoform service before requesting report exports. Note for reviewers: all export timestamps are stored in UTC and converted to the requesting account's timezone at render time, so any diff in expected output usually traces back to the `display_tz` header rather than the data layer. Local testing reads credentials from the environment; for convenience in the sandbox, use the key below.

gateway credential: kto3_qfe

Action item (Wrenfall log-tail outage): the `fluecat` CLI hammered the aggregator with unbounded reconnects after the broker restart, tripling ingest load. Fix shipped: bounded retries, jittered backoff, and a hard cap on concurrent tails per user. Release manager: include this in the next patch train and block older CLI versions at the gateway. Rollback is safe but re-exposes the reconnect storm. New limits must match ops sign-off. The enforced constants are as follows.

tuning table, yajog-yahof:
BUDGETS = {
    "lamvan": 303,
    "wenox": 460,
    "fenvan": 525,
}

Management Meeting Minutes — Warranty Overrun

Present: Voss, Arkwright, Demelo. Apologies: Trent.

1. Warranty costs on the Corvane drive units exceeded budget by 62k this quarter. Root cause: bearing failures traced to the Hollis Ridge assembly line.
2. Provision increased; finance to restate Q4 outlook by Friday.
3. Supplier claim against Bramfield Castings to be pursued; Demelo leads.
4. Monthly warranty dashboard to be circulated to finance going forward.

Next review in four weeks. The confidential note on business plans is set out below.

internal memo for yahag-tahog: The pricing group signed off on a budget of $152.8 million for Project Soriel.